Market System Selection enables you to identify market systems that will give you the best opportunity to achieve your goals. It involves explicitly comparing market systems against one another, and requires you to gather information, design criteria and ultimately make decisions on where to focus.

After brainstorming a long list of potential market systems, you will identify a set of selection criteria against which to judge the market systems. The final decision must be evidence-based, but it is ultimately a subjective judgment call. Iterative investigation will help you to balance rigour with practicality and make a final decision that is based on informed discussion and deliberation.
